New York A03805 allows public participation in meetings in person or remotely via technology.
New York Assembly Bill A03805 amends the public officers law and public buildings law to enhance public participation in meetings. It allows the public to join meetings in person or remotely using technology such as telephone, video conference, or other similar means. The bill also mandates that public meetings be open to recording and broadcasting. Public bodies can adopt rules for the use of equipment and personnel involved in these activities, in line with recommendations from the committee on open government.
